The water temperature for the Gulf of Mexico (West Coast) ranges from the high 50s to high 60s. The Atlantic Ocean(East Coast) waters average mid-to-high 50s from Central Florida north. The beaches to the south - West Palm Beach, Miami and The Keys - are always several degrees warmer than those in North Florida. Source: http://goflorida.about.com/od/allaboutflorida/a/january.htm

The average ocean water temperature of San Francisco Bay ranges from around 52°F (11°C) in the winter months to about 60-65°F (15-18°C) in the summer months.

The average surface water temperature of the Great Lakes varies throughout the year. In summer, temperatures can range from the low 60s to low 70s Fahrenheit, while in winter, they can drop below freezing. The average annual temperature for the Great Lakes hovers around 45-50 degrees Fahrenheit.
